CommuteSmart.info offers one-stop shop for
travel
Regional website offers handy tools for
drivers, carpoolers, transit users

County transportation agencies from San Bernardino, Riverside,
Los Angeles, Orange and Ventura discussed the idea of a regional
commuting website in September 2004 and launched the site in
January. The site was developed through a partnership between
the Los Angeles County Department of Public Works and the
Riverside County Transportation Comission.
In September 2005,
Commutesmart.info was upgraded with maps that cover a larger
geographical area, including the Cajon Pass, San Bernardino
mountain resorts and the desert regions to the Nevada and
Arizona borders. These areas are especially sensative to
weather and recreational travel conditions, so it was important
to include them, Kirkhoff said.
Traffic Map Features
One of the most popular features of the website is its traffic
updates, which provide real-time traffic information. The maps
show accidents, lane closures and other "live" traffic problems
for 11 areas:
- San Bernardino / Riverside Counties
- Cajon Pass
- San Bernardino Mountain Resorts
- Coachella Valley
- South Riverside County
- Orange County
- Los Angeles County
- City of El Segundo / LAX
- North Los Angeles County
- San Diego County
- Ventura County
In addition, the maps show views from Caltrans freeway cameras in
the Inland Empire and include the text of changeable message signs,
such as Amber Alerts. In other Southland areas, the maps show
freeway speeds and estimates travel times between freeway sections.
Commuting Help
But wait, there's more! Commuters can get help with
finding carpool or vanpool partners through a database of more than
400,000 people in Southern California. By entering basic
information about daily commute patterns, solo drivers can find
themselves ridesharing in no time.
Those who prefer to travel by rail or by bus - for work or for
recreation - can check out the Bus / Rail Planner section of the
website. Using a route planner developed by the Metropolitan
Transportation Authority, riders simply enter their destination,
time and day of travel and several other parameters, and the site
will create a suggested customized route for trips all over the
region.
Further, people who rideshare can learn about rebates and other
incentives that they can receive for carpooling, vanpooling, taking
mass transit or cycling to work. For example, in San
Bernardino County, those who rideshare can earn $2 per day for the
first three months.
Lots, Lanes & Links
CommuteSmart.info also has a listing and map of Park & Ride lots
by city and by county. In addition, the site includes a map of
existing carpool lanes and carpool lanes that are under construction
and explains the benefits and policies of using these lanes.
Links also are in place to Caltrans roadwork advisories in San
Bernardino, Riverside, Orange and Los Angeles counties.
